The World:
Spoiler:
The world of Pokémon, a dynamic place full of mysteries and legend. Balance in this fabulous world is kept by Pokémon with amazing abilities and power, called the legendary Pokémon. Humans interact with Pokémon on various ways, training them to battle, to perform in coordination shows and other activities. By their power which is hardly possible to control and importance to the world's balance, legendary Pokémon aren´t found with humans often, showing up only when the time is of urgent need.
But something is making the world lose its balance, natural disasters are often, and climate is changing. It all began to happen after one night, when a big spot of light that was visible in all parts of the Pokémon world divided in what looked to be 16 different rays of light. And they fell like falling stars. Expecting what would be a great treasure, scientists, treasure hunters, Pokémon trainers, and curious people in general began to search for the fallen stars.
Strangely, they had all fallen in an unexplored island, not habited except for the local tribes, ancient societies that roamed the wild environment present there. The island had the size of a continent, so the search could take some time. By those reasons the journey to find the "treasure" was a hard one. Moved by curiosity, adventure, and some by greed, many humans traveled to the island to be the ones to find the fallen stars. But they didn't last long. The lack of civilized buildings to heal their Pokémon and themselves, the roughness of the climate, and the untamed wilderness of the island proved too much. Only a small community stayed in one little village they created that they called Lianea, living in huts with an improvised Pokécenter and Pokémart, trying to support the ones that still dared to adventure the island. This new continent was later called Fallar.

Gameplay rules:
Spoiler:
- This is a dynamic Pokémon game, there will be no levels. I can tell you sometimes an estimated value, still it won´t be very important. Pokémon know all the attacks they learn naturally from their birth. The question is that they can´t use them properly in their full strength if they are untrained to do so. Think of it a bit like skill points. Let´s pick Charmander as an example. You can use flamethrower in the beginning of the game, still it would most probably result in a failure, since he wouldn't be able to concentrate the amount of energy needed for the attack. So it would prove way more ineffective than if you used a standard ember. As the Pokémon progresses on experience, he gets better using the attacks he uses the most. And the more experienced he is, the easier it will be for him to acquire stronger battle techniques. Egg moves or move tutor moves are not included in this. Those may be won on certain events that will happen in the world, or for great posting.
- When wanting to capture a Pokémon leave the post at ball rolling. Depending on various factors like rarity, difficulty to capture, the post itself I will let you know the outcome.
- Evolution will work also work by events, great posts, and a new factor, Pokémon personality that I will also explain.
- No catching legendary Pokémon.
- Characters will not find each other at the beggining of the game. They may even catch the same boat but they won´t interact. Interaction will be saved for later.
- Once you reach a certain place, I will place in the OOC thread a post talking about the place. That post will have information of areas of interest, Pokémon that can be found, and the environment that you find yourself into. As I want to dedicate to the world around you the most, I will not be playing the game, except for some NPC if I see the need to.
- The region is undiscovered, therefore there is no map. You must design it yourself as you progress the world, so that you can move faster if you need to return to a certain place.
- The world will be full of puzzles, and many possibilities. Remember you're playing a character and if you reach a place where another person has already solved the puzzle you can´t act like you already know it. Still, don´t give up visiting different areas, as there will be places only accessible on secret ways that will surely not be all discovered all in one time.
- The OOC thread will serve as a guide to know your current state. Pokémon, items, basically all that. When you post something new, depending on the quality and inovation of the post you may win something. If that happens I will post it on your OOC thread part, so check it often. Also registration is to be done in the OOC thread.
- I got most part of the puzzles worked out, but excellent posts and different ways to solve the puzzles than the ways I have thought will be rewarded, it may even get new possibilities in my head, and help the story expand, so go for it!
- The personality factor: The trainer and the Pokémon they caught will have a personality factor. Trainer will work on how they react to the world and different situations as a normal RPG game. Different happenings in the world may affect every being in a different way. That´s my base on Pokémon personality. The way it connects to you and the things you pass on as a trainer will be crucial for the Pokémon development, like evolution as an example.
- Im willing to answer any questions, if you think this concept hard to understand.
